Overview
This tuning, affectionately named "Lounge Drone D# Phrygian Tuning," arose from a serendipitous moment, as the original description states: "This was the random tuning my guitar in my lounge was left it, it was a bit out of tune, but I managed to round down the tuning to this." It’s a notably low and dark tuning, with every string dropped down from standard EADGBe. The resulting open notes create a unique and somewhat exotic sonic landscape, leaning heavily into a modal sound rather than a straightforward major or minor chord, perfect for atmospheric and introspective playing.
Technical Analysis
The open strings present the notes, from low to high: D#3, G2, C3, F3, A#4, D#5. When these unique notes are ordered by pitch, we find G, A# (Bb), C, D# (Eb), F. This combination closely aligns with the G Phrygian scale (G-Ab-Bb-C-D-Eb-F). Strummed openly, this tuning produces a rich, resonant, and distinctly modal sonority, immediately evoking a sense of the exotic, Spanish, or Middle Eastern musical styles. The presence of two D# notes (on String 6 and String 1) an octave apart, along with an A# (Bb) on String 2, provides powerful open drones and sustained harmonies, contributing to its "Lounge Drone" character.
While this tuning doesn't form a simple major or minor triad when strummed openly, its unique arrangement of notes offers intriguing harmonic and melodic possibilities:
- The open strings fundamentally provide a G Phrygian sonority, which is excellent for exploring modal compositions and creating an atmospheric, sometimes melancholic, feel.
- The low D# on String 6 and the high D# on String 1 act as powerful anchors, allowing for open octave work and deep, resonant power chords when combined with the A# (Bb) on String 2.
- The sequence of G2, C3, F3 (Strings 5, 4, 3) offers a suspended quality in the mid-range, creating open voicings reminiscent of Gsus4 or a Cmaj/G inversion.
- This tuning is exceptionally well-suited for creating ambient soundscapes, dark and introspective pieces, or even heavy, detuned riffs, especially given the overall low pitch. Barred chords and partial chords will take on new and unexpected voicings, inviting creative exploration beyond conventional shapes.
How to Tune
To set your guitar to the "Lounge Drone D# Phrygian Tuning" from standard EADGBe, please follow these precise string movements:
- String 6 (Low E): Tune down 1 semitone from E to D#3.
- String 5 (A): Tune down 2 semitones from A to G2.
- String 4 (D): Tune down 2 semitones from D to C3.
- String 3 (G): Tune down 2 semitones from G to F3.
- String 2 (B): Tune down 1 semitone from B to A#4.
- String 1 (High E): Tune down 1 semitone from E to D#5.
Please take care when tuning. Generally, for string movements exceeding 4 semitones (either tuning up or down), considering a different string gauge is advisable to maintain optimal tension, tone, and string integrity, though this particular tuning involves movements within a safe range.
